Eine populäre Legende führt das Zeichen auf englische Bogenschützen im Hundertjährigen Krieg zurück, doch gibt es dafür keinen Beleg. Danach war das eine trotzige Geste der englischen Bogenschützen, dass sie die Zeige- und Mittelfinger zur Handhabung des Bogens noch hatten. WebAnalysis Of Winston Churchill's Campaign 'V For Victory'. On the 19th of July 1941, two years into the war, Winston Churchill endorsed a campaign called “V for Victory”. He advocated the campaign in a speech to the nation of Britain. The campaign inspired millions of citizens that they could get through the hard times of the war.
